Indonesian climber Rahmad Adi is targeting gold at the 2022 Asian Games in Hangzhou and believes he has what it takes to top the podium at the event in the Chinese city.

Adi made the confident prediction off the back of his victory at the International Federation of Sport Climbing Connected Speed Knockout, a virtual event organised earlier this month to fill the void of sporting competitions caused by the coronavirus pandemic.

The speed specialist is also an Asian Youth Championships gold and bronze medallist.

"I keep practicing, and I will make the target," the 19-year-old said, according to China's official state news agency Xinhua.

Adi has also set his sights on a medal at the 2024 Olympic Games in Paris, and hopes to use Hangzhou 2022 as a springboard for further international success.

Sport climbing is one of 40 sports on the programme for the 2022 Asian Games.

More than 10,000 athletes are expected to compete at the Games, scheduled to run from September 10 to 25.
